·设为首页收藏本站📧邮箱修改🎁免费下载专区📒收藏夹👽聊天室📱AI智能体
返回列表 发布新帖

飞鸟同城相亲运营版报错提示(1146) Table 'fn_member' doesn't exist解决办法

510 1
发表于 2021-9-13 10:39:03 | 查看全部 阅读模式

马上注册,免费下载更多dz插件网资源。

您需要 登录 才可以下载或查看,没有账号?立即注册

×
飞鸟同城相亲运营版报错提示(1146) Table 'fn_member' doesn't exist解决办法:

如图所示:
飞鸟同城相亲运营版报错提示(1146) Table 'fn_member' doesn't exist解决办法 飞鸟,同城,相亲,运营,版报


解决办法:
后台——站长——数据库——升级:
如果没有看到输入框,需要将 config/config_global.php 当中的 $_config[admincp][runquery] 设置修改为 1。

  1. CREATE TABLE `pre_fn_member` (
  2.   `id` int(11) unsigned NOT NULL AUTO_INCREMENT,
  3.   `mid` int(11) unsigned NOT NULL,
  4.   `uid` int(11) unsigned NOT NULL,
  5.   `username` varchar(100) NOT NULL,
  6.   `face` varchar(255) NOT NULL,
  7.   `name` varchar(50) NOT NULL,
  8.   `name_type` tinyint(1) unsigned NOT NULL DEFAULT '1',
  9.   `mobile` varchar(30) NOT NULL,
  10.   `sex` tinyint(1) unsigned NOT NULL,
  11.   `birth` varchar(20) NOT NULL,
  12.   `birth_province` varchar(30) NOT NULL,
  13.   `birth_city` varchar(30) NOT NULL,
  14.   `birth_dist` varchar(30) NOT NULL,
  15.   `birth_community` varchar(30) NOT NULL,
  16.   `reside_province` varchar(30) NOT NULL,
  17.   `reside_city` varchar(30) NOT NULL,
  18.   `reside_dist` varchar(30) NOT NULL,
  19.   `reside_community` varchar(30) NOT NULL,
  20.   `age` tinyint(3) unsigned NOT NULL,
  21.   `constellation` tinyint(1) unsigned NOT NULL,
  22.   `animal` tinyint(1) unsigned NOT NULL,
  23.   `height` tinyint(3) unsigned NOT NULL,
  24.   `weight` tinyint(3) unsigned NOT NULL,
  25.   `blood` tinyint(1) unsigned NOT NULL,
  26.   `ethnic` tinyint(1) unsigned NOT NULL,
  27.   `company` varchar(255) NOT NULL,
  28.   `occupation` tinyint(3) unsigned NOT NULL,
  29.   `education` tinyint(1) unsigned NOT NULL,
  30.   `marriage` tinyint(1) unsigned NOT NULL,
  31.   `home` tinyint(1) unsigned NOT NULL,
  32.   `child` tinyint(1) unsigned NOT NULL,
  33.   `month_income` tinyint(1) unsigned NOT NULL,
  34.   `house` tinyint(1) unsigned NOT NULL,
  35.   `vehicle` tinyint(1) unsigned NOT NULL,
  36.   `hobby` varchar(255) NOT NULL,
  37.   `vip_time` int(11) unsigned NOT NULL,
  38.   `expire_vip_push` tinyint(1) unsigned NOT NULL,
  39.   `param` mediumtext NOT NULL,
  40.   `lead_line` tinyint(4) unsigned NOT NULL,
  41.   `lead_line_state` tinyint(1) unsigned NOT NULL,
  42.   `see_line` tinyint(3) unsigned NOT NULL,
  43.   `click` int(11) unsigned NOT NULL,
  44.   `display` tinyint(1) unsigned NOT NULL,
  45.   `examine` tinyint(1) unsigned NOT NULL,
  46.   `mobile_display` tinyint(1) unsigned NOT NULL DEFAULT '1',
  47.   `wx_display` tinyint(1) unsigned NOT NULL,
  48.   `seal` tinyint(1) unsigned NOT NULL,
  49.   `top_dateline` int(11) unsigned NOT NULL,
  50.   `display_dateline` int(11) unsigned NOT NULL,
  51.   `dateline` int(11) unsigned NOT NULL,
  52.   `updateline` int(11) unsigned NOT NULL,
  53.   `source` tinyint(1) unsigned NOT NULL,
  54.   PRIMARY KEY (`id`)
  55. ) ENGINE=MyISAM;
复制代码


我要说一句 收起回复
一花一世界,一叶一追寻。一曲一场叹,一生为一人。

评论1

Discuz智能体Lv.8 发表于 2025-3-21 13:18:37 | 查看全部
根据你提供的错误信息 `(1146) Table 'fn_member' doesn't exist`,这表明在数据库中缺少 `fn_member` 表。这个问题通常是由于插件安装不完整或数据库表未正确创建导致的。

### 解决办法:

1. **检查数据库表前缀**:
   - 首先,确认你的数据库表前缀是否正确。默认情况下,Discuz 的表前缀是 `pre_`,但有些站点可能会自定义表前缀。你可以在 `config/config_global.php` 文件中找到 `$_config['db']['1']['tablepre']` 来确认表前缀。

2. **手动创建缺失的表**:
   - 如果确认表前缀正确,但仍然缺少 `fn_member` 表,你可以通过以下 SQL 语句手动创建该表:

  
  1. CREATE TABLE `pre_fn_member` (
  2.      `id` int(11) unsigned NOT NULL AUTO_INCREMENT,
  3.      `mid` int(11) unsigned NOT NULL,
  4.      `uid` int(11) unsigned NOT NULL,
  5.      `username` varchar(100) NOT NULL,
  6.      `face` varchar(255) NOT NULL,
  7.      `name` varchar(50) NOT NULL,
  8.      `name_type` tinyint(1) unsigned NOT NULL DEFAULT '1',
  9.      `mobile` varchar(30) NOT NULL,
  10.      `sex` tinyint(1) unsigned NOT NULL,
  11.      `birth` varchar(20) NOT NULL,
  12.      `birth_province` varchar(30) NOT NULL,
  13.      `birth_city` varchar(30) NOT NULL,
  14.      `birth_dist` varchar(30) NOT NULL,
  15.      `birth_community` varchar(30) NOT NULL,
  16.      `reside_province` varchar(30) NOT NULL,
  17.      `reside_city` varchar(30) NOT NULL,
  18.      `reside_dist` varchar(30) NOT NULL,
  19.      `reside_community` varchar(30) NOT NULL,
  20.      `age` tinyint(3) unsigned NOT NULL,
  21.      `constellation` tinyint(1) unsigned NOT NULL,
  22.      `animal` tinyint(1) unsigned NOT NULL,
  23.      `height` tinyint(3) unsigned NOT NULL,
  24.      `weight` tinyint(3) unsigned NOT NULL,
  25.      `blood` tinyint(1) unsigned NOT NULL,
  26.      `ethnic` tinyint(1) unsigned NOT NULL,
  27.      `company` varchar(255) NOT NULL,
  28.      `occupation` tinyint(3) unsigned NOT NULL,
  29.      `education` tinyint(1) unsigned NOT NULL,
  30.      `marriage` tinyint(1) unsigned NOT NULL,
  31.      `home` tinyint(1) unsigned NOT NULL,
  32.      `child` tinyint(1) unsigned NOT NULL,
  33.      `month_income` tinyint(1) unsigned NOT NULL,
  34.      `house` tinyint(1) unsigned NOT NULL,
  35.      `vehicle` tinyint(1) unsigned NOT NULL,
  36.      `hobby` varchar(255) NOT NULL,
  37.      `vip_time` int(11) unsigned NOT NULL,
  38.      `expire_vip_push` tinyint(1) unsigned NOT NULL,
  39.      `param` mediumtext NOT NULL,
  40.      `lead_line` tinyint(4) unsigned NOT NULL,
  41.      `lead_line_state` tinyint(1) unsigned NOT NULL,
  42.      `see_line` tinyint(3) unsigned NOT NULL,
  43.      `click` int(11) unsigned NOT NULL,
  44.      `display` tinyint(1) unsigned NOT NULL,
  45.      `examine` tinyint(1) unsigned NOT NULL,
  46.      `mobile_display` tinyint(1) unsigned NOT NULL DEFAULT '1',
  47.      `wx_display` tinyint(1) unsigned NOT NULL,
  48.      `seal` tinyint(1) unsigned NOT NULL,
  49.      `top_dateline` int(11) unsigned NOT NULL,
  50.      `display_dateline` int(11) unsigned NOT NULL,
  51.      `dateline` int(11) unsigned NOT NULL,
  52.      `updateline` int(11) unsigned NOT NULL,
  53.      `source` tinyint(1) unsigned NOT NULL,
  54.      PRIMARY KEY (`id`)
  55.    ) ENGINE=MyISAM;
复制代码


   - 将上述 SQL 语句复制到 Discuz 后台的“站长 -> 数据库 -> 升级”页面中执行。如果没有看到输入框,需要将 `config/config_global.php` 文件中的 `$_config['admincp']['runquery']` 设置为 `1`。

3. **重新安装插件**:
   - 如果手动创建表后问题仍然存在,建议你尝试重新安装飞鸟同城相亲插件。在重新安装之前,请确保备份好数据库和文件,以防数据丢失。

4. **检查插件安装日志**:
   - 如果插件安装过程中有日志记录,检查日志文件,看看是否有其他错误信息,可能会帮助你找到问题的根源。

5. **联系插件开发者**:
   - 如果以上方法都无法解决问题,建议你联系插件的开发者或技术支持团队,提供详细的错误信息和操作步骤,以便他们帮助你进一步排查问题。

### 注意事项:
- 在执行任何数据库操作之前,请务必备份数据库,以防数据丢失。
- 如果你对数据库操作不熟悉,建议在操作前咨询有经验的开发者或管理员。

希望这些步骤能帮助你解决问题。如果还有其他问题,欢迎继续提问!
-- 本回答由 人工智能 AI智能体 生成,内容仅供参考,请仔细甄别。
我要说一句 收起回复

回复

 懒得打字嘛,点击右侧快捷回复【查看最新发布】   【应用商城享更多资源】
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关闭

站长推荐上一条 /1 下一条

AI智能体
投诉/建议联系

discuzaddons@vip.qq.com

未经授权禁止转载,复制和建立镜像,
如有违反,按照公告处理!!!
  • 联系QQ客服
  • 添加微信客服

联系DZ插件网微信客服|最近更新|Archiver|手机版|小黑屋|DZ插件网! ( 鄂ICP备20010621号-1 )|网站地图 知道创宇云防御

您的IP:18.219.77.39,GMT+8, 2025-3-29 05:25 , Processed in 0.242344 second(s), 74 queries , Gzip On, Redis On.

Powered by Discuz! X5.0 Licensed

© 2001-2025 Discuz! Team.

关灯 在本版发帖
扫一扫添加微信客服
QQ客服返回顶部
快速回复 返回顶部 返回列表